Fellow Mordelians,

Yes I am yes behind but I am more of a strategy and tactics guys, not light them up with Lasers guy. So I have MW4, and MW4 Mercenaries and have been playing. But I suck.

Funny thing is in the pods I am actually decent, but it it the layout that makes it easy for me to torso twist, change weapons, targeting, etc. So this keyboard and joystick thing sucks for me.

I am using a Wingman Attack 2 joystick. What are you all using? My big problems are torso twisiting, reverse throttle, and changing views.

Let me know what you like and why, and if you remember th cost let me know.

Ugh the biggest poroblem is it all comes down to budget. The more you want to spent the better the joystick set up you can get.

I do prefer the CH Products line though. http://www.chproducts.com/retail_flash/index.html Here is the link

Take a look at the FighterStickUSB and the Pro Throttle USB As good as they are they both retail for 149.99 each. But they are both completely programable Pro Pedals USB can be added as well for another 149.99 but it does offer some amazing flexibility And it really has a great feel to it.

Now granted this isnt what I have (the wife forbade the purchase and wont enertain a purchase for a while). but I have used this set up and LOVE it.

I used to use the Microsoft Sidewinder Pro before my accident. It was wonderful. 10 buttons with 1 big one that i used to reverse speed, a hat for view, a throttle control, and a Z axis on the joystick for torso twists. Plus it was USB capable. Overall I was very pleased. I can't remember the cost atm thou.

You should be able to buy a good flight controller now a days that comes with a throttle control stick for a good price. These setups usually have God awful amounts of buttons and toys.

I use the Logitech Extreme 3D Pro (linky). It's got USB, 12 buttons, a hat switch, twist, and a throttle. The throttle's just a little lever, but it works well enough. And that's for $30.00; not that much for a good stick that's lasted me several years now. I've used a few sticks before this one, but this and its predecessor (a Logitech Wingman) are the best I've used.

Quote:

On 2005-07-25 11:21, AWAD wrote:
My big problems are torso twisiting, reverse throttle, and changing views.


Torso twisting works well enough with the twisting stick, or at least it has for me.

Reverse throttle is simple enough. On my stick, the forward three-quarters of the throttle is forwards, and the rear quarter or so makes you go backwards. It takes a little practice to get to a dead stop with it like that, but I don't even hesitate with it by now. (It's been a few years that I've had this stick and MW4 Mercs.)

Changing views I can't help you with, as I don't really change views. I just stay with the forward view. I set my hat switch to things other than view; namely toggling zoom and target selection. I think I might have a button set for coolant flush, but I'm not sure.

Like Vagabond I too used the Sidewinder (not sure if it was the pro or not, but I think it was/is). Now that I have a new motherboard with integrated sound, I may need to get a new joystick, but I must look to see if I have the right connection still.

You definitely need a stick with at least some kind of throttling lever on the side and a Z-axis control. Everything else is just gravy after that.
